G2 reviewers report that FaceUp excels in overall user satisfaction, reflected in its higher G2 Score of 81.94 compared to Whispli's 49.68. This suggests that users find FaceUp to be a more reliable choice for their whistleblowing needs.
Users say that Whispli offers a highly responsive customer support experience, with many praising the team's flexibility and quick integration process. One user noted, "The platform itself is really simple and easy to use," highlighting its user-friendly design.
Reviewers mention that FaceUp's setup process is seamless, with one user stating that the support team answered every question promptly. This ease of implementation is a significant advantage for organizations looking to quickly adopt a whistleblowing solution.
According to verified reviews, both products receive high marks for usability, but FaceUp edges out with a slightly better user experience score. Users appreciate its intuitive design, making it accessible for all age groups, which is crucial for widespread adoption within organizations.
G2 reviewers highlight that Whispli's structured application and hands-on customer support for urgent requests are standout features. Users have noted the platform's effective reporting workflows and automations, which enhance the overall reporting experience.
Users report that while both platforms meet their requirements effectively, FaceUp's broader market presence and larger number of reviews (158 vs. Whispli's 75) suggest a more established product with a proven track record in the mid-market segment.
